Transaction 073d89b992691fdfbfe18fda4339ca0061285c06caf07da4801b80fa6e991732

7 Input
2 Outputs
  • 073d89b992691fdfbfe18fda4339ca0061285c06caf07da4801b80fa6e991732:0
  • value  825797
    address  3Pu3F24xXNtibf3RRVj54aJZh12exFQWPm
  • 073d89b992691fdfbfe18fda4339ca0061285c06caf07da4801b80fa6e991732:1
  • value  2100452730
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s